Output 3baa8d3a4ade2dab438003f1c4a33446399dca851908b294d00d9cabd25e52cf:0

value
9584192
script pubkey
OP_0 OP_PUSHBYTES_20 1956a48596384a4ed2fb043c6e83b518531c73fb
address
bc1qr9t2fpvk8p9ya5hmqs7xaqa4rpf3culmz2rt5l
transaction
3baa8d3a4ade2dab438003f1c4a33446399dca851908b294d00d9cabd25e52cf
confirmations
308584
spent
false

4 Sat Ranges